Zip 37659 centers on historic Jonesborough, Tennessee’s oldest town, with brick-lined streets, 19th-century storefronts, and the International Storytelling Center anchoring a lively calendar (Music on the Square, the National Storytelling Festival). Set amid rolling Appalachian foothills, it offers four distinct seasons—mild winters, lush springs, and warm, green summers—plus easy outdoor time at Persimmon Ridge Park, the Wetlands Water Park, nearby Buffalo Mountain, and the Tweetsie Trail. Daily life feels friendly and low-key, with family- and pet‑friendly vibes, front-porch culture, and local spots like Main Street Cafe, Depot Street Brewing, and The Corner Cup, plus groceries at Food Lion and Ingles; bigger shopping and gyms are a short hop in Johnson City via US‑11E and I‑26. Per Zillow’s Rental Manager market trends, recent median asking rent is around $1,300/month, with most listings roughly $900–$1,800. Popular weekend routines include hiking, paddling the Nolichucky, browsing boutiques downtown, and catching a show at the Jonesborough Repertory Theatre.
